With school starting and schedules settling down, now is the time to add extra-curricular and enrichment opportunities to your family's weekly routine. Many of our fall classes start in just a few short weeks with registration deadlines fast approaching. New programs include Buckets and Boots, Family Circus Workshop, and Tennis Clinic from Empact Tennis. Old favorites also return such as Start Smart Soccer and Tai Chi. Some of our students' favorite instructors are also offering fall programming such as Pegboard Paint & Stitch from Hailey Loftis and Volleyball Instruction with Michelle Wood.
